Description:
The Daily DX - a text DX bulletin sent via e-mail to your home or office Monday through Friday and includes DX news, IOTA news, QSN reports, QSL information, a DX Calendar, propagation forecast and much, much more. With a subscription to The Daily DX you will also receive DX news flashes and other interesting DX tidbits.

OE3SGU Rating: 2015-01-25
Good Time Owned: 3 to 6 months.
I really like receiving DX-news in a compact and regular form like the Daily DX provides. Of course there is nothing that one cannot read in other - mostly free of charge - sources on the web, but The Daily DX usually brings them first.

The name is a bit misleading, there is no newsletter on weekends and during vacations etc. so it is not really "The Daily DX" but rather "The Regular DX".

What I really don't like is the unstructured DX news. While every other source usually starts with the DXCC-prefix of the news that follow, this one does (for whatever reason) not. Often I had to read the whole paragraph only to realize that the topic or activity it is about is not of interest. Other than that it is ok.

M0TRN Rating: 2013-10-12
Would be hard to do without it Time Owned: more than 12 months.
The Daily DX is always first with the important DX news, and misses nothing of interest to the serious (or less serious) DX'er. It's concise and to the point, and stays in a recognizable format so it's easy to skim for the most important stuff if you don't have time to read the whole thing.

Also the additional newsflashes that are sent out when something of importance to the community happens are invaluable.
